Amitriptyline hydrochloride
AMITROPH is a medication classified as a tricyclic antidepressant (TCA). It is primarily used to treat depression, but it can also be prescribed for other conditions such as chronic pain, migraine prevention, and certain sleep disorders.
AMITROPH works by increasing the levels of certain neurotransmitters, particularly norepinephrine and serotonin, in the brain. By doing so, it helps to improve mood, reduce feelings of depression, and alleviate certain types of pain.
In depression, AMITROPH helps to rebalance the chemicals in the brain that are associated with mood regulation. It can take several weeks for the full antidepressant effects to be felt, and it is usually prescribed at a low dose initially, which may be gradually increased based on the individual's response and tolerability.
In addition to its antidepressant properties, AMITROPH also has analgesic effects, which can help relieve certain types of chronic pain. It is often used for conditions such as neuropathic pain, fibromyalgia, and migraine prevention. The exact mechanism by which amitriptyline reduces pain is not fully understood, but it is thought to involve modulation of pain signals in the central nervous system.
AMITROPH is available in tablet form, and the dosage and duration of treatment will depend on the specific condition being treated, individual patient factors, and the healthcare provider's recommendations.
It's important to note that AMITROPH can have side effects. Common side effects may include dry mouth, drowsiness, dizziness, constipation, and blurred vision. It can also have potential interactions with other medications, so it's important to inform your healthcare provider about all the medications, supplements, and herbal products you are taking.
AMITROPH should be taken as prescribed by a healthcare provider, and it's generally recommended to follow the prescribed dosage and duration of treatment. Abruptly stopping AMITROPH or changing the dosage without medical supervision can lead to withdrawal symptoms, so it's important to work with a healthcare professional when discontinuing the medication.
